How they compare

Mauritius currently reports 25.08 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ent against 11.68 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ent in Sub-Saharan Africa, a difference of 13.4 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ent.

That makes Mauritius's figure about 2.1 times Sub-Saharan Africa's.

Across all 34 years both countries report, Mauritius has been ahead every year.

Mauritius ranks 26th and Sub-Saharan Africa ranks 25th of 171 countries.

Mauritius has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Mauritius Sub-Saharan Africa Difference Ahead
1990s 9.6 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ent 4.1 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ent 5.5 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ent Mauritius
2000s 12.4 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ent 6.1 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ent 6.31 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ent Mauritius
2010s 18.02 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ent 8.58 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ent 9.44 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ent Mauritius
2020s 23.01 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ent 10.63 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ent 12.38 PPP $ per kg of oil equivalent Mauritius

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

GDP per unit of energy use is the PPP GDP per kilogram of oil equivalent of energy use. PPP GDP is gross domestic product converted to current international dollars using purchasing power parity rates based on the 2017 ICP round. An international dollar has the same purchasing power over GDP as a U.S. dollar has in the United States.
